CANADIAN SEASON KICKS OFF
The past weekend was the first taste of racing in Canada this season for flying Kiwis Mason Phillips and Kieran Leigh.
Racing for the Kini Red Bull KTM Race Team at round one of the Canadian national championships, at Kamloops, in British Columbia, the two Kiwi riders were right in the thick of the action.
Waikato’s Leigh qualified 15th in a field of 69 in the MX2 class, then twice finished 10th, good enough for 9th overall on the day.
Mount Maunganui’s Phillips was racing in the MX1 class and qualified 15th, before going on to finish 11th and 30th for 14th overall, a problem with his rear suspension ruining his prospects in moto two.
